James Duncan Scurlock (born September 15, 1971) is an American director, producer, writer and financial adviser. He is probably best-known for his critically acclaimed documentary Maxed Out: Hard Times, Easy Credit and the Era of Predatory Lenders and his award winning book, Maxed Out: Hard Times in the Age of Easy Credit.

Born in Seattle, Washington, he attended the Wharton School, University of Pennsylvania, studying finance, but left in his senior year without receiving a degree. While in college, he opened four restaurants, which he sold in 1994. He then moved to Dallas, where he published a successful investing newsletter titled Restaurant Investor and wrote freelance for several magazines.
